Proof: Campaigns That Reached the Bestseller List and Beyond

Michael Richards, Entrances & Exits — East 2 West Collective ran the publicity campaign for the Emmy-winning actor's memoir, timed around his continued popularity from Seinfeld's ongoing life on Netflix. The campaign landed the book on the New York Times bestseller list.

Justine Bateman, Face: One Square Foot of Skin (Akashic Books) — The campaign built a media list spanning national broadcast, women's-focused digital platforms, and high-end magazines around a single question: why can't women feel free to age on their own terms? In Bateman's own words: "Her concentrated approach caused Amazon.com to sell out of the book twice within the first week of the book's release, and caused outlets like Time Magazine and 60 Minutes Australia to knock on our door, unsolicited."
